Subject: Term Sheet from Merrow & Dunne

All — Merrow & Dunne sent their distribution term sheet yesterday. Key points: three-year exclusivity in the Calder region, 12% margin floor, quarterly volume commitments. Legal is reviewing; expect redlines by Thursday. Sales leads, hold any related pipeline conversations until then. Strategic context is set out just below.

board note of tadup-tajog: Headcount on the Oliiel team goes from 31 to 88 by the end of February. Gross margin on Oliiel came in at 62 percent against a plan of 29 percent.

Action item from the Renderbarn outage: the transcode farm stalled because the job-claim lease outlived the worker health check, so dead workers held shards for twenty minutes. Fix: lease TTL must be shorter than two health-check intervals, and the requeue backoff must not exceed the lease. On-call should verify the deployed values against the agreed table, reproduced here.

constants for bawif-kawif:
QUOTAS = {
    "ulaael": 5,
    "holael": 10,
}

### Action Item 4: Audit wiki role assignments

During the Larkvale incident, a contractor account retained editor rights on the Opsline wiki three months after offboarding, which allowed the stale runbook edit that misdirected responders. Owner: platform team, due end of quarter. As the incoming contractor, you'll receive viewer access by default; request elevation only per-space, and expect a 90-day expiry on all grants. The access request workflow and role matrix are documented on the internal page linked below.

dashboard of hadug-bajef = https://superset.crelvonet.corp/settings/display/ticket/view/secrets/display/pipeline/ff837826542183d07687e3ad

## Authentication

All traffic into the Ferndock gateway is rate limited per service identity — 300 requests a minute by default, bursts up to 500 for ten seconds. Limits are enforced before auth is even checked, so a flood of bad tokens still gets squashed. Worth noting for your review: identities are minted by the Larkspur provisioning job, and keys rotate every 45 days automatically. Anonymous calls are rejected outright, no grace path. The reviewer sandbox identity authenticates with the key below.

service key, fawip-bajef: kto11_Qt5wZK9vdNC